Sinolink: "Energy + Conflict" as the Core Pricing Factor for Molybdenum, Industry Demand Remains Strong
In the first half of 2026, Chinas net imports of molybdenum reached 18,900 tons, an increase of 124.0% year-on-year. Coupled with a steady decline in domestic inventory, this reflects the sustained demand for molybdenum.
Sinolink published a research report stating that from 2004 to 2008, the expansion of investment in the energy industry combined with supply bottlenecks drove a rapid rise in molybdenum prices. From 2009 to 2015, supply expansion and slowing demand led to a long-term slump in molybdenum prices. From 2016 to 2020, traditional demand recovery drove price corrections, while external shocks put additional pressure on the market. Since 2021, with the expansion of energy chemical and advanced manufacturing demand and limited supply increments, the price of molybdenum has continued to rise. Molybdenum: A Key Element in High-End Manufacturing and Energy Chemicals
Molybdenum possesses a high melting point, high-temperature strength, high thermal conductivity, and a low thermal expansion coefficient, along with excellent alloying properties, making molybdenum and its alloys suitable for specialized fields such as electronic devices, heat treatment equipment, and metal processing.
New Generation Storage Interconnect Materials, Driven by AIs Expansion of High-End Demand
As 3D NAND technology advances to over 300 layers, tungsten word lines face constraints such as rising resistance and RC delays. Molybdenum, at the nanoscale, has a lower effective resistivity and potential for integration without a barrier layer and high aspect ratio structure filling. Samsung Electronics has introduced molybdenum metallization processes in its ninth generation of 3D NAND, and SK Hynix also plans to switch some word line materials from tungsten to molybdenum in its next generation products. With the expansion of storage demand driven by AI, the application of molybdenum in 3D NAND is expected to open up new opportunities for advanced processes and drive growth in the demand for high-purity molybdenum raw materials and molybdenum-containing precursors.
Demand: High-End Manufacturing Flourishing, Energy Chemicals Rising
According to IMOA, global molybdenum usage is expected to increase by 3.6% year-on-year to 304,700 tons in 2025, with Chinas usage also up by 10.8% year-on-year to 153,200 tons, accounting for 50.3% of global demand; the CAGR for global and Chinese molybdenum usage from 2020 to 2025 is projected to be 4.5% and 7.6%, respectively. According to ferroalloy.com, domestic steel tender volume is expected to rise from 120,800 tons in 2023 to 157,000 tons in 2025, with 82,700 tons tendered in the first half of 2026, a year-on-year increase of 8.4%. Energy Chemicals: The oil and gas and thermal power sectors remain robust, with more upward potential. In early March 2026, Brent crude oil prices broke above $80 per barrel, and accounting for the lag in capital expenditure, demand for related equipment is expected to significantly rebound from the third quarter of 2026, supporting molybdenum demand in the energy chemicals sector. High-End Manufacturing: Shipbuilding leads the way, with wind power and construction machinery showing a positive resonance. From January to June 2026, the global shipbuilding completion volume reached 60.77 million deadweight tons, an increase of 30.5% year-on-year. The rebound in high-end manufacturing is expected to drive molybdenum demand for high-strength steel, special steel, and large alloy components. Strategic Demand: Steady growth in defense budgets, sustained high investment in high-end equipment, and stable growth in molybdenum demand for high-performance alloys.
Supply: Declining Overseas, Slow Domestic Increase
Global molybdenum production is projected to be around 305,100 tons in 2025, an increase of 5.1% year-on-year; of this, China, South America, and North America will account for 44.9%, 26.1%, and 19.9%, respectively, with the by-product nature of molybdenum restricting short-term supply elasticity. Overseas major mining companies are guiding lower production for 2026, with expected molybdenum production overseas for 2026-2028 at 159,400 tons, 156,600 tons, and 156,500 tons, down 2.2%, 1.8%, and 0.0% year-on-year, respectively; domestic increases are primarily from projects like the second phase of Jilong Copper Mine and Dasyu Molybdenum Mine, with supply increments expected to be limited.
Supply and Demand Balance: Molybdenum Supply-Demand Gap Expected to Continue Widening
The bank projects that global molybdenum demand will increase by 4.6%, 3.6%, and 3.3% year-on-year for 2026-2028, while global supply will increase by 0.5%, decrease by 0.2%, and increase by 2.1%, respectively, corresponding to a widening supply-demand gap of 22,000 tons, 34,000 tons, and 39,000 tons for those years. This tightening supply-demand pattern is expected to support the price center of molybdenum.
